When visiting Twin Falls, you never want to simply drive on through. In fact, this southwestern Idaho town is the perfect place for a meal and the Depot Grill is where you need to go. This restaurant has been a staple in Twin Falls since 1917 and serves breakfast, lunch, and dinner. And while the history of this restaurant is certainly unique, so is the food. Each day, this restaurant serves homemade dishes that are going to bring a smile to your face and ensure you leave with a full belly.
The Depot Grill is a family-owned and operated restaurant located at 545 Shoshone Street in Twin Falls. This restaurant first opened its doors in 1917 — more than a century ago — and it's the perfect stop for any hungry Idahoan.
This restaurant is open from 7 a.m. to 9 p.m. each day and serves breakfast, lunch, and dinner. However, breakfast is one reason many individuals come to this Twin Falls restaurant. Here, you will find a menu with more than 85 different breakfast dishes — many that are homemade — making it easy to find something to start your day off right.
You’ll find classic breakfast dishes on the menu like a variety of omelets, pancakes, waffles, French toast, biscuits and gravy, and more. You can also try items like pork chops and eggs or corned beef hash.
While many of the breakfast dishes are homemade, so are the lunch and dinner menu items as well. Even the hamburger patties are cut and ground in-house!
The lunch and dinner menus are quite extensive. There are more than half a dozen salad options, finger steaks, chicken tenders, two dozen types of sandwiches, and so much more available.
There really is something for every taste bud and every craving at this Twin Falls restaurant.
You also can’t go wrong with this restaurant’s famous Golden Glow Fried Chicken. This is hand-breaded and pressure cooked to perfection. The hand-made, in-house chicken fried steak is also a must-try at the Depot Grill. Seafood, steaks, pork chops, and many other entrees are also excellent choices if visiting for dinner.
And to complete the perfect meal, try one of the desserts. The homemade pies are quite popular and after one bite, you’ll understand why. Try a homemade sweet roll as well — they may just become your new favorite sweet treat.
With a long history, an extensive menu, and tons of homemade food, you’ll notice the difference when you visit the Depot Grill in Twin Falls. In fact, you may find yourself making a special trip to this southwestern Idaho town just for a bite of your favorite dish.
